# makefile to compile MCPP version 2.7.2 and later for MinGW / GCC / GNU make
# 2008/09 kmatsui
#
# First, you must edit GCCDIR, BINDIR, INCDIR, gcc_maj_ver and gcc_min_ver.
# To make compiler-independent-build of MCPP do:
# make
# make install
# To make GCC-specific-build of MCPP:
# make COMPILER=GNUC
# make COMPILER=GNUC install
# To re-compile MCPP using GCC-specific-build of MCPP do:
# make COMPILER=GNUC PREPROCESSED=1
# make COMPILER=GNUC PREPROCESSED=1 install
# To link malloc() package of kmatsui do:
# make [COMPILER=GNUC] [PREPROCESSED=1] MALLOC=KMMALLOC
# make [COMPILER=GNUC] [PREPROCESSED=1] MALLOC=KMMALLOC install
# To make libmcpp (subroutine build of mcpp):
# make MCPP_LIB=1 mcpplib
# make MCPP_LIB=1 mcpplib_install
# To make testmain using libmcpp (add 'DLL_IMPORT=1' to link against DLL):
# make [OUT2MEM=1] testmain
# make [OUT2MEM=1] testmain_install
# COMPILER:
# Specify whether make a compiler-independent-build or GCC-specific-build
# compiler-independent-build: empty
# compiler-specific-build: GNUC
